The chi(1)-interaction parameters of poly(dimethyl siloxane) with methyl ethyl ketone at very low polymer concentration were determined by means of intrinsic viscosity (IV) measurements at several temperatures. The chi(t)(infinity)-total interaction parameters of the same system at infinitely high polymer concentration were also determined using inverse gas chromatography (i.g.c.) technique around the same temperature range. Then, exchange enthalpy, X-12, and entropy, Q(12), parameters in the Flory's equation of state theory were determined from the obtained interaction parameters. Both X-12 and Q(12) parameters obtained by TV are lower than those found by i.g.c.. (C) 1997 Elsevier Science Ltd.
